Shah Latif Town

Shah Latif Town is a residential area located in Karachi, Pakistan. It is named after the famous Sufi poet Shah Abdul Latif Bhittai. The neighborhood is known for its peaceful ambiance and well-maintained streets.

Shah Latif Town has a mix of commercial and residential properties, making it a popular choice for families looking for a quiet place to call home.

Shah Latif Town Famous Food

Must-Try local dishes

Biryani

A fragrant rice dish layered with spiced meat or vegetables, Biryani is a popular must-try local dish in Shah Latif Town. It can be found at many local eateries and restaurants across the area.

Must-Try!

Sindhi Pulao

Sindhi Pulao, a delicious and aromatic rice dish cooked with meat, spices, and caramelized onions, is a specialty of the region. It's a must-try and can be savored at traditional eateries and food stalls.

Saji

Saji, a roasted meat dish traditionally prepared on a slow fire, is a flavorsome and succulent specialty of the area. Visitors can enjoy Saji at local eateries and during festive occasions.
